It is one of two institutions of higher education owned by the state government via PIYS: the other being INPENS International College.
[3] UNISEL operates from two campuses: one in the township of Bestari Jaya and another in the state capital, Shah Alam.
[5] The main campus is on a 1,000-acre (4.0 km2) lot which is part of a 4,000 acres (16 km2) piece of land that has been earmarked as the Selangor Educational Park.
